Can We Buy an IELTS Certificate? A Comprehensive Guide
The International English Language Testing System (IELTS) is among the most commonly recognised English‑language efficiency exams worldwide. Universities, immigration authorities, and companies frequently require an IELTS certificate as evidence of a candidate's ability to communicate in English. Because the test brings substantial weight in academic and expert decisions, some people wonder whether it is possible to buy an IELTS certificate instead of sit for the exam. This article checks out the answer to that question, lays out the legitimate pathway to getting an IELTS certificate, and highlights the dangers connected with fraudulent offers.
The Short Answer
No-- a genuine IELTS certificate can not be acquired. The only method to get an official IELTS certificate is by taking the test at an approved test centre and attaining a rating that satisfies the required band level. Any site, representative, or private claiming to sell a "genuine" IELTS certificate is practically certainly running a scam. Getting or utilizing a fake certificate is illegal and can cause extreme effects, including prosecution, visa refusal, and bans from future test efforts.
How the Genuine IELTS Process Works
- Registration: Candidates should create an account on the official IELTS registration website (operated by the British Council, IDP, or Cambridge Assessment English) and select an test date at an authorised centre.
- Recognition: On test day, prospects provide a legitimate, government‑issued ID (e.g., passport) for confirmation.
- Taking the Test: The exam consists of 4 parts--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king-- each scored on a band scale from 1 to 9.
- Scoring and Reporting: After the test, certified examiners mark the documents. Outcomes are generally offered online 13 days after the paper‑based test (or within 5‑7 days for computer‑delivered tests).
- Issuance of the Test Report Form (TRF): The official file, commonly called the IELTS certificate, is either sent by mail to the candidate or can be downloaded as a digital PDF from the test centre's portal. Universities and immigration agencies can validate the authenticity of the TRF utilizing a special TRF number.

Steps to Obtain an IELTS Certificate Legitimately
- Select the appropriate test type (Academic for university admissions; General Training for immigration or work).
- Prepare thoroughly using official IELTS practice products, online courses, or coaching centres.
- Register early to secure a convenient test date and place.
- Arrive on test day with the needed ID and a clear understanding of the test format.
- Get the Test Report Form (TRF) after the results are released.
- Submit the TRF straight to the organizations that require it; most organisations accept digital copies verified via the IELTS Result Verification Service.
Warning-- How to Spot IELTS Certificate Scams
- "Guaranteed pass" or "money‑back" claims: Legitimate test centres never ensure a specific band score.
- Cost far below main costs: If a deal appears too low-cost, it is likely a scams.
- Demands for individual files (passport scans, bank information) before any payment or registration.
- No proven test centre location: Scammers frequently operate entirely online without a physical workplace.
- "Instant" certificates: The official process takes a minimum of a number of days after the test date; there is no immediate issuance.
- Requests for payment through untraceable methods such as cryptocurrency, gift cards, or Western Union.
Why People Consider Buying a Certificate-- And Why It's Not Worth It
Some candidates fear they lack the language ability needed to pass IELTS, while others may require a high band score urgently for visa or work deadlines. The temptation to "buy" a certificate can arise from these pressures. Nevertheless, the risks far surpass any short‑term advantage:
- Legal repercussions: Many countries deal with file fraud as a criminal offense, which can cause fines or imprisonment.
- Profession and academic damage: If a forged certificate is found after admission or work, the individual can be expelled, terminated, and blacklisted from future chances.
- Monetary loss: Scammers often take the cash and vanish, leaving the victim with no certificate at all.
- Mental tension: The constant worry of being exposed can cause considerable anxiety.
